The 180-day guarantee, in detail

This is the strongest single feature of the offer, and it deserves an explanation rather than a badge.

Purchases go through ClickBank, which acts as the retailer of record rather than as a payment gateway. That distinction matters: the refund obligation sits with an established company that processes returns as routine business, not with a supplement brand that may or may not answer its email. It is why we treat this guarantee as meaningfully enforceable, unlike the "guarantees" attached to products sold through anonymous checkouts.

  1. Keep your order number. It arrives in the confirmation email. Also note the statement descriptor, which will not say "Gluco6".
  2. Give the product a fair trial. Eight to twelve weeks minimum, taken consistently with your largest meal.
  3. Decide before day 180. The window runs from purchase date, not delivery date. Set a calendar reminder at day 150 so it does not slip.
  4. Contact support and request the refund. Include the order number. Opened and empty bottles are covered under the published policy.
  5. Refund is processed to your original payment method, typically within a few business days once approved.

Is there a subscription or recurring charge?
No. Gluco6 packages are one-time purchases. You are not enrolled in an auto-ship programme and there is no recurring billing to cancel. If you see a recurring charge on your statement, contact ClickBank support immediately, because it did not originate from a standard order.
What appears on my bank statement?
ClickBank is the retailer of record, so the charge typically shows as CLKBANK or a similar descriptor rather than as the product name. This surprises people and is a frequent cause of unnecessary chargeback disputes — check for that descriptor before assuming something is wrong.
